How the Nagpur–Melbourne journey is built

This is a two-flight or three-flight trip. From Nagpur you take a domestic leg to Delhi or Mumbai, then a single connection over South-East Asia or the Gulf to Melbourne. The lowest total times come via Singapore Airlines (SIN) or one-stop Gulf options on Emirates (DXB) and Qatar Airways (DOH). Qantas and Malaysia Airlines also serve MEL. Book it on one ticket where possible to protect baggage and connections.

Melbourne Airport (MEL) and onward transport

You arrive at Melbourne Airport (MEL) at Tullamarine, about 23 km north-west of the CBD. The SkyBus runs frequently to Southern Cross Station in roughly 30–45 minutes, and taxis/rideshare take around 30 minutes off-peak. Australian biosecurity is strict, so declare any food and complete your Incoming Passenger Card honestly to avoid fines.

Baggage for a long-haul to Australia

Full-service carriers to Melbourne usually allow 2 x 23 kg (Singapore Airlines, Qantas) or 30–35 kg weight-based on Gulf carriers in economy. The domestic Nagpur leg on a low-cost airline may include only 15 kg, so book a through-fare to keep allowances aligned. Students moving for study often buy extra baggage online, which is far cheaper than airport rates.

Best time to fly and typical fares

Round-trip economy from central India to Melbourne typically runs ₹70,000–₹1,30,000 depending on season and routing, peaking around December–January and the Indian festival period. The cheaper windows are May–June and August. Book 2–4 months ahead for the best long-haul fares, and compare metro hubs as price gaps can be large.

Why Indians travel to Melbourne

Melbourne has one of Australia's largest Indian communities, world-ranked universities, and big cricket events at the MCG. Visitors enjoy laneway cafés, the Great Ocean Road, Yarra Valley wineries and Indian restaurants across the suburbs. It is a major destination for students, skilled migrants and parents visiting children, which keeps demand — and seasonal fares — high. Many families time visits to the December–January summer or the Boxing Day Test, while students fly in around the February and July intakes. Allowing 2–3 weeks for a holiday lets you add Tasmania or a Sydney leg without a separate long-haul.

Australia visa for Indian passport holders

Indians need a visa before flying to Australia. Tourists usually apply for the Visitor visa (subclass 600) online; some travel agents can also lodge an eVisitor-style application, but the subclass 600 is the standard tourist route. Processing can take a few weeks, so apply early with bank statements, itinerary and accommodation. Check current requirements in our visa guide before booking non-refundable tickets.

Frequently asked questions

Is there a non-stop flight from Nagpur to Melbourne?

No. There is no non-stop; you make 1–2 stops via a metro hub plus Singapore, KL or the Gulf, totalling roughly 15–20 hours.

How long is the flight from Nagpur to Melbourne?

Plan on 15–20 hours total with connections; the long-haul leg alone (e.g. Singapore–Melbourne) is around 7–8 hours.

How far is Melbourne from Nagpur?

The distance is about 10,300 km, which is why every itinerary needs at least one stop.

Do Indians need a visa for Australia?

Yes. Indian tourists must obtain a Visitor visa (subclass 600) before travel; processing can take a few weeks, so apply early.

Which airlines are best for this route?

Singapore Airlines, Qantas, Emirates, Qatar Airways and IndiGo connections work well, with 1–2 stops via Asia or the Gulf.

What is the time difference with Melbourne?

Melbourne is 4h 30m ahead of India in standard time and 5h 30m ahead during daylight saving (UTC+10/+11).
